E32-UTAT1-3F Product Overview

Introduction

The E32-UTAT1-3F is a versatile electronic component that belongs to the category of ultrasonic sensors. This entry provides an in-depth overview of the product, including its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Ultrasonic Sensor
  • Use: Distance measurement, object detection
  • Characteristics: High accuracy, non-contact sensing, compact design
  • Package: Enclosed in a durable housing
  • Essence: Utilizes ultrasonic waves for precise measurements
  • Packaging/Quantity: Typically sold individually or in small quantities

Specifications

  • Operating Voltage: 5V DC
  • Detection Range: 20cm to 300cm
  • Output Type: Analog or digital signal
  • Operating Temperature: -25°C to 70°C
  • Dimensions: Compact form factor for easy integration

Detailed Pin Configuration

The E32-UTAT1-3F features a standard pin configuration: 1. Vcc (Power supply) 2. GND (Ground) 3. Trig (Trigger input) 4. Echo (Echo output)

Working Principles

The E32-UTAT1-3F operates based on the principle of emitting ultrasonic waves and measuring the time taken for the waves to reflect off an object and return to the sensor. By calculating the time difference, the sensor accurately determines the distance to the object.
